The chillers market plays a crucial role in global industrial and commercial operations, offering advanced solutions for temperature control and efficient heat removal in processes ranging from air conditioning to manufacturing. Chillers are mechanical devices designed to remove heat from liquids, ensuring optimal temperature levels for industrial machinery, chemical production, and commercial buildings. As industries and infrastructure expand, the global chillers market continues to evolve, driven by demand for energy efficiency, sustainable refrigerants, and technological innovation.

Technological Advancements

Recent technological developments have transformed the chiller market. Manufacturers are focusing on producing chillers that offer better energy efficiency, reduced noise levels, and minimal maintenance. The integration of IoT-enabled systems has allowed real-time performance tracking and predictive maintenance, reducing downtime. Magnetic bearing chillers, variable speed drives, and hybrid cooling systems are some of the advanced technologies reshaping the industry. These innovations are enabling industries to achieve operational excellence while meeting environmental and energy standards.

Segmentation and Application Insights

Chillers are segmented into types such as air-cooled, water-cooled, and absorption chillers. Among these, water-cooled chillers dominate the market due to their higher energy efficiency and suitability for large industrial applications. However, air-cooled chillers are gaining popularity in regions with water scarcity due to their convenience and lower maintenance needs. The application of chillers spans various sectors, including chemicals, plastics, power generation, and healthcare, each requiring precise cooling to maintain product integrity and process stability.
